Just recieved a letter from Mike. He is doing well, he's a squad leader and has this message for any Poolees that want to know;

A. Don't come HUGE or untrained as it will ruin your experience.

B. Knowledge is power

C. God you won't understand a ****ing thing about this place until you step on this Island! It's impossible to prepare for anything, clear your mind, shut your damn mouth, and get your ass on line!

Then he said "ALL RECRUITS ARE JUST ORDINARY MEN, TRYING TO DO AN EXTRORDINARY THING".

I also have a special message for the following people; jinelson, KBS95125, Rvillac, Kurby, and Marine84. If you people will PM me I will relay that info to you ASAP.

He also says that Jakob Burkett is doing well in another platoon.

HIs letter was dated this past Monday, he began training The next day. So Nov 2 is his Graduation day.

In a letter I got today, Mike seems to be going thru the first phase blahs! His platoon is beginning to grow at a pace that they can't keep up with, they are at each others throat, in other words. He is still not getting much mail and he NOW understands why mail is important. He said that any of you that want to write him, feel free to PM me for his address. He said he'd even welcome trash mail from some of us old salts, he said he wouldn't mind the 1/4 deck if he got mail. He has not lost his motivation, but he would really love to hear from any and all Poolees that know him from this site.

Oh yea, two squad leaders got fired when his SDI went off on them the other night-----yep he lost his billet. So that hurt his pride as well, but like I said he is still motovated and wants to go on with it all.

His advice to the ones leaving for MCRD anytime soon:

"EITHER SOUND OFF LOUD OR KEEP YOUR MOUTH SHUT!" :evilgrin:
